Automation philosophy
Automate friction, not judgment.
The best automation projects do not begin with a tool. They begin with a repetitive process, a bottleneck, a missed follow-up, or a task that consumes more staff time than it should.
Graphic Marks focuses on practical systems that support the team rather than creating a complicated technology stack that becomes another thing to manage.

How we work
Identify the friction first, then choose the technology.
A useful automation project maps the existing workflow, identifies high-value repetitive steps, defines human review, and implements the simplest reliable system that solves the problem.
1. Assess
Review current tools, workflows, team pain points, data quality, and realistic automation opportunities.
2. Prioritize
Choose the highest-value workflows based on impact, effort, risk, and team readiness.
3. Design
Map triggers, actions, data requirements, approvals, human review, and success measures.
4. Implement
Configure the workflow, templates, prompts, documentation, and integrations needed for the selected use case.
5. Train & Improve
Help the team use the system, review quality, measure results, and refine it over time.

Do we need to replace our current marketing tools?
Usually not. The first step is understanding what your current tools can already do and where better configuration or workflow design can solve the problem.
Can you help with HubSpot automation?
Yes. Support can include CRM organization, lifecycle stages, forms, lists, email workflows, lead routing, follow-up tasks, campaign structure, and practical automation planning.
Can AI write all of our marketing content?
AI can assist with research, drafting, repurposing, ideation, and repetitive production, but important content still benefits from human strategy, fact-checking, brand judgment, and approval.
How do we know what should be automated?
Good candidates are repetitive, rules-based tasks with clear inputs and outputs. High-stakes judgment, sensitive communication, and work requiring nuanced context should retain appropriate human oversight.
